Animal Trading cards


-Dars. Brauzer hodisalari bilan ishlash


Download 0.93 Mb.
bet42/45
Sana31.01.2024
Hajmi0.93 Mb.
#1831329
1   ...   37   38   39   40   41   42   43   44   45
Bog'liq
FrontEnd uz Final

10-Dars. Brauzer hodisalari bilan ishlash

2. Hodisalarga javob berish


1-savol
Quyidagi kodda hodisaning turi qanday?
const lotsOfElements = document.querySelectorAll('.quizzing-quizzby');

const element = lotsOfElements[2];


element.addEventListener('animationend', function () {
const mainHeading = document.querySelector('h1');


mainHeading.style.backgroundColor = 'purple';
});

Izoh:
Ushbu animationend satri hodisa tinglovchisining turi hisoblanadi.
2-savol
Ushbu kod berilgan:
document.addEventListener('keypress', function () {
document.body.remove();
});
Sichqoncha sahifaga bosilganda nima sodir bo‘ladi?



Izoh:
Ushbu kod tinglovchini faqat klavish tugmachasi bosilgandagina o‘rnatadi. Garchi hujjat bosilsa ham hech qanday tinglovchi o‘rnatilmaganligi sababli bosish e’tiborga olinmaydi.
2-savol
Quyidagi interfeyslar haqida o‘ylab ko‘ring:

  • EventTarget

  • Node

  • Element

Bu ikkalasi o‘rtasida farq bormi:

  • document.addEventListener()

  • myHeading.addEventListener() (o‘ylang myHeading variantli elementdir)

Javob:
Albatta farq bor, document.addEventListener() hodisa tinglovchisini butun hujjat uchun tayinlaydi, ya’ni foydalanuvchi veb sahifaning ixtiyoriy joyida sichqoncha bilan chertsa, hodisa tinglovchisi ishlaydi, myHeading.addEventListener() esa faqat shu elementni o’ziga.

3. Hodisa tinglovchisini olib tashlash


1-savol
Quyidagi tenglik sinovi qanday natija ko‘rsatadi, true yoki false?
{ name: 'Richard' } === { name: 'Richard' }

https://www.youtube.com/watch?v=A1hfTM8pagg&feature=emb_logo

Download 0.93 Mb.

Do'stlaringiz bilan baham:
1   ...   37   38   39   40   41   42   43   44   45




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ling